Below is: a list of governors of the: Central Provinces and Berar and theββprecursor offices associated with that title:
Chief commissioners of Nagpur Province. And Saugor Nerbudda territoriesβ»
- 1861β1862: Edward King Elliot
Chief commissioners of the Central Provincesβ»
- 1862β1864: Edward King Elliot
- 1864β1867: Sir Richard Temple, "Bt."
- 1867β1883: Sir John Henry Morris
- 1883β1884: William Brittain Jones
- 1884β1885: Sir Charles Haukes Todd
- 1885β1887: Dennis Fitzpatrick
- 1887β1889: Alexander Mackenzie
- 1889β1893: Sir Antony Patrick Macdonnell
- 1893β1895: Sir John Woodburn
- 1895β1898: Sir Charles James Lyall
- 1898β1899: Sir Denzil Charles Jelf Ibbetson
- 1899β1902: Sir Andrew Henderson Leith Fraser
- 1902β1904: John Prescott Hewett
- 1904β1905: Frederic Styles Philpin Lely
- 1905β1906: John Ontario Miller
- 1907β1912: Reginald Henry Craddock
- 1912β1920: Sir Benjamin Robertson
- 1920: Sir Frank George Sly
Governors of the Central Provincesβ»
- 1920β1925: Sir Frank George Sly
- 1925β1932: Sir Montagu Sherard Dawes Butler
- 1932β1936: Sir Hyde Clarendon Gowan
Governors of the Central Provinces and Berarβ»
- 1936β1938: Sir Hyde Clarendon Gowan (Edpuganti Raghavendra Rao from 15.05.1936ββto 11.09.1936 Acting governor in place of Gowan)
- 11.09.1936β03.03.1938: Sir Hyde Clarendon Gowan
- 03.03.1938β27.05.1938: Sir Hugh Bomford (acting)
- 01.06.1938β01.07.1940: Sir Francis Verner Wylie
- 17.09.1940β16.09.1946: Sir Henry Joseph Twynam
- 16.09.1946β15.08.1947: Sir Frederick Chalmers Bourne
